I am using Postgres 8.3 and slony 2.0.6.
I have tried to upgrade Postgres 8.3 to Postgres 9.0.3 using PG_UPGRADE and
I come across this issue .

Checking for invalid 'name' user columns                    fatal

        | Your installation contains the "name" data type in
        | user tables.  This data type changed its internal
        | alignment between your old and new clusters so this
        | cluster cannot currently be upgraded.  You can
        | remove the problem tables and restart the migration.
        | A list of the problem columns is in the file:
        |       /opt/tables_using_name.txt

             List of tables :
          -_oxrsaero.sl_table.tab_relname
          -_oxrsaero.sl_table.tab_nspname
          -_oxrsaero.sl_table.tab_idxname
          -_oxrsaero.sl_sequence.seq_relname
          -_oxrsaero.sl_sequence.seq_nspname
          -_oxrsaero.vactables.relname
